Canon SX200 IS vs Casio EX-ZR100 Overview

Below is a extended overview of the Canon SX200 IS vs Casio EX-ZR100, both Small Sensor Superzoom cameras by brands Canon and Casio. The sensor resolution of the SX200 IS (12MP) and the EX-ZR100 (12MP) is relatively close and they feature the exact same sensor sizes (1/2.3").

The SX200 IS was unveiled 3 years prior to the EX-ZR100 and that is a fairly serious gap as far as camera technology is concerned. The two cameras come with the identical body type (Compact).

Canon SX200 IS vs Casio EX-ZR100 Physical Comparison

If you are looking to lug around your camera frequently, you're going to have to take into account its weight and size. The Canon SX200 IS enjoys physical dimensions of 103mm x 61mm x 38mm (4.1" x 2.4" x 1.5") with a weight of 247 grams (0.54 lbs) and the Casio EX-ZR100 has specifications of 105mm x 59mm x 29m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.1") along with a weight of 204 grams (0.45 lbs).

Canon SX200 IS vs Casio EX-ZR100 Sensor Comparison

Typically, it can be difficult to visualise the gap in sensor measurements just by viewing a spec sheet. The graphic underneath may give you a more clear sense of the sensor dimensions in the SX200 IS and EX-ZR100.

Clearly, the 2 cameras posses the exact same sensor measurements and the same resolution so you should expect comparable quality of images although you should really consider the production date of the cameras into account. The older SX200 IS will be behind with regard to sensor tech.
